One 30 min. over the phone interview with easy non-technical questions. Why do you want to be a software developer? Talk about a project you worked on. Are you willing to relocate? Then you get a chance to ask questions. The interviewer was a software developer and he was informative in answering my questions. Very polite as well. Then you are required to complete an exam on Proctoru.com that consists of 4 parts: 2-min speed test with about 10 easy questions but hard to get done in 2 minutes, a math part that is easy with a simple calculator (you are not allowed a more advanced one) with some brain teasers that are probably meant to eat up time, a new programming language part that is easy but you need to be careful on some parts as they are tricky, and finally a programming part in C/C++ or Java with 4 questions that took up a lot of time for me. Overall I spent about 4.5 hours. You do the exam remotely on your computer anywhere you like but you have someone monitoring you over webcam. You should be knowledgeable in data structures (arrays and linked lists) and fundamental algorithms, strings(converting to decimals via ASCII), etc. Be ready to take a lengthy exam!
